JSC RASCOM is a joint venture of VimpelCom, which controls 54% of its authorized capital, and JSC Russian Railways (46% of shares). At the same time, Russian Railways has a subsidiary trunk operator - TransTeleCom (TTK).

The construction of the new TEA NEXT fiber-optic communication line continues; in the future, it will connect the western and eastern borders of Russia with connections to the country's largest cities and exits to the Russia-Mongolia-China border and the coastal station of underwater communication lines in Nakhodka. According to Atlas, more than 1,500 km of the TEA NEXT fiber-optic communication line route in the European part of the Russian Federation are already ready. By the end of 2025, Atlas plans to extend the line to Mongolia and China. According to the operator's plans, the entire land part of the communication line, which is part of the first stage of construction taking place on the territory of Russia, will be completely ready in 2026. In parallel, the necessary infrastructure for international extensions of the lines will be provided.

The design capacity of the fiber-optic communication line will be 96 dark fibers, which will be used as a transit resource for communication between Asia and Europe and by Russian operators in the country. At the same time, the TEA NEXT route will pass along a new optimal route. The project is of particular importance for the connection of the Asian region with Europe, since it will offer a full-fledged reliable alternative to marine cable systems that pass through the Indian Ocean and Egypt.
